Book Synopsis Graph Algebra by : Courtney Brown

Download or read book Graph Algebra written by Courtney Brown and published by SAGE. This book was released on 2008 with total page 105 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book describes an easily applied language of mathematical modeling that uses boxes and arrows to develop very sophisticated, algebraic statements of social and political phenomena.
